Buying Guide

  • Power source: Decide between pneumatic (air-powered) systems and battery-powered devices. Pneumatic models excel in continuous industrial use but require an air compressor and hoses; battery models offer portability and smaller footprints.
  • Capacity and kinetics: For wet-dry tasks, check tank or bucket capacity and the vacuum’s max suction (or CFM/L/min). Higher capacity reduces downtime for emptying.
  • Materials compatibility: If you handle oils, coolants, or metal chips, confirm the system has corrosion-resistant parts and appropriate filtration.
  • Portability vs. fixed installation: Large drum or bucket systems suit fixed stations; compact hand-held units suit mobile technicians.
  • Accessory ecosystem: Look for a broad kit of nozzles, brushes, seals, or bags to maximize versatility across surfaces.
  • Safety and maintenance: Ensure automatic shut-offs, safety valves, and easy access for cleaning or filter changes.
  • Operational environment: Consider noise levels, air consumption, and whether electrical or air-powered options pose risks in flammable or wet areas.

FAQ

  1. What is the main advantage of a 3-in-1 air duster and vacuum?

    Answer: It consolidates blowing, vacuuming, and bag sealing into one device, reducing tool clutter and enabling quick transitions between tasks.
  2. Can these units handle liquids and oils safely?

    Answer: Some models are designed for liquids and oils (Drum Vac, INTBUYING-style extractors) but always confirm compatibility with the specific liquid type and drum or bucket material.
  3. Are pneumatic vacuum systems suitable for metal chips?

    Answer: Yes, several models are built for metal chips and coolant handling, especially those with robust stainless steel components and high filtration.
  4. Do cordless dusters replace canned air for prolonged use?

    Answer: They offer portability and refillable power but may require frequent charging for long sessions; for heavy usage, plan for charging intervals.
  5. What should I consider when choosing a wet/dry vacuum for a workshop?

    Answer: Look at suction power, liquid handling capacity, filtration efficiency, and the ability to connect to a standard drum or bucket if needed.
